Pyrus ussuriensis
Fast growing, very early flowering, dark brown buds begin to open revealing a light pink colour before bursting into a beautiful spring show of white flowers. The dark green foliage is oval in shape with serrated edges, Autumn colour is a rich, dark red.
The Manchurian Pear has a straight upright trunk with horizontal branches, making it the very best ornamental pear for pleaching. (Pleaching simplified is growing a trimmed hedge on a tall bear trunk.)
Grows in a dense round shape.
Growth in Melbourne, Victoria – Height: 7 Meters Width: 6 Meters
